I was annoyed last night at Esme judging hat boy for not using an overlocker - saying that it would fray in the first wash. It won't. It is knit fabric and doesn't fray. His choice of a twin needle when there is lots of fabric to go through was a good one imo.

glamorousgrandmother · 20/02/2019 14:01

Yes French it is perfectly OK to sew knits without an overlocker (I always used to before I got on overlocker and sometimes still do) but maybe, for the purposes of the competition, they wanted to see people use one.

The bias...basically the diagonal.
Thread runs straight up and down a piece of cloth, the bias is the corner to corner angle. It makes for fabric that moulds to a shape a bit.
